What is the general format of the Reading and Writing questions on the PSAT/NMSQT?

Explanation:
Reading and Writing questions on the PSAT/NMSQT are presented as multiple-choice items, each with four answer options. This format tests skills like understanding passages, determining meaning in context, and spotting correct grammar or editing choices, all within concise prompts tied to the text. You pick the option that best fits what the question asks—whether it’s the best way to phrase a sentence, the correct interpretation of a detail, or the right grammatical choice. There are no essay prompts, true/false statements, or short-answer responses in this section, which is why the description of having four options aligns exactly with how these questions are structured.
